Detailed Description

This is a utility class to convert VTK array data and VTK tables to and from Gnu R S expression (SEXP) data structures. It is used with the R .Call interface and the embedded R interpreter.

This class creates deep copies of input data. Created R SEXP variables created by these functions can be freed by the R garbage collector by calling UNPROTECT(1). The conversions are performed for double and integer data types.

VTK data structures created by this class from R types are stored in array collections and freed when the class destructor is called. Use the Register() method on a returned object to increase its reference count by one, in order keep the object around after this classes destructor has been called. The code calling Register() must eventually call Delete() on the object to free memory.

Create a vtkDataArray copy of GNU R input matrix vaiable (deep copy, allocates memory) Input is a R matrix or vector of doubles or integers

vtkArray* vtkRAdapter::RToVTKArray ( SEXP  variable)

Create a vtkArray copy of the GNU R input variable multi-dimensional array (deep copy, allocates memory) Input is a R multi-dimensional array of doubles or integers

Create a GNU R matrix copy of the input vtkDataArray da (deep copy, allocates memory)

Create a GNU R multi-dimensional array copy of the input vtkArray da (deep copy, allocates memory)

Create a GNU R matrix copy of the input vtkTable table (deep copy, allocates memory)

vtkTable* vtkRAdapter::RToVTKTable ( SEXP  variable)

Create a vtkTable copy of the GNU R input matrix variable (deep copy, allocates memory) Input is R list of equal length vectors or a matrix.

SEXP vtkRAdapter::VTKTreeToR ( vtkTree tree)

Create a GNU R phylo tree copy of the input vtkTree tree (deep copy, allocates memory)

vtkTree* vtkRAdapter::RToVTKTree ( SEXP  variable)

Create a vtkTree copy of the GNU R input phylo tree variable (deep copy, allocates memory)
